Austin American-Statesman, July 16, 2008 Linda Smith, a 59-year-old grandmother, was shocked to learn she was pregnant again, more than 35 years after having her first child. UTMB's Dr. Charlie Brown, Austin-based residency training program director for obstetrics and gynecology, said there is conflicting data about the level of risk faced by women who become pregnant after 50. "Most people agree the risk increases as a woman gets older. The question is to what degree."
